Supergirl​​​​ was renewed for a fourth season by The CW on April 2, 2018. It premiered on October 14, 2018 and concluded on May 19, 2019. The season consisted of 22 episodes.

Trivia

  • This season airs on Sundays at 8/7c, as opposed to the past three seasons, where it aired on Mondays at the same time.
  • Manchester Black was originally going to be the main antagonist of this season.[1]
  • Jeremy Jordan was supposed to appear in a recurring role this season, but unfortunately he was unable to. He will possibly appear in the fifth season.[2]
    • This also means that this is the first season without Jeremy Jordan (Winn Schott) being featured in any shape or capacity.
  • This is the first season of Supergirl to have humans as main antagonists.
    • Interestingly enough, at the same year in which this season aired, The Flash had a series first with a female main antagonist (in its fifth season).
    • This is also the only season where the main antagonists are not killed.
  • The final episode of the season introduced Malefic J'onzz, the brother of J'onn J'onzz as well as the shadow secret group known as Leviathan.
